Transaction 3f72dab4f0b3ad895aed51a6249e103f721aead9d5b4bdff22d60f81ec789e95
1 Input
1 Output
-
3f72dab4f0b3ad895aed51a6249e103f721aead9d5b4bdff22d60f81ec789e95:0
- value
- 44016
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 743dd3ebfd1692de3c641a887d51407338b5ac21 OP_EQUAL
- address
- 3CHeNfiRh8vSSE7ibWZqpu1pHfNPVZQMbZ